Is this yet another fuckup on Paramount's part, or does the whole franchise reside with WB now?
WB has home video rights to 9, 10, JvF, and remake exclusively, and rights for 1-8 for three years due to their deal with Paramount.

Paramount currently has film rights.

Originally Posted by Spiderbite
and I need to keep my old BD of the uncut version of the first movie, correct?
No. The first movie is the uncut version (it, along with 2 and 3) are the same exact discs Paramount released.

Also, if you're into features, you'll need to keep the Friday the 13th Part 3 disc in the "From Crystal Lake to Manhattan" Ultimate Edition DVD Collection set which contains a commentary which, for some reason, Paramount never carried over to the Deluxe Edition DVD and Blu-ray...
